Understanding the Core Skills Required

The first step in mastering data validation techniques is understanding the core skills required to manage and validate data effectively. These include:

# 1. Data Profiling and Analysis

Data profiling involves examining the data to understand its structure, content, and quality. This technique helps identify anomalies, inconsistencies, and missing values early in the process. Effective data profiling tools and techniques are crucial for ensuring that data meets the necessary quality standards before it is used for decision-making.

# 2. Statistical Methods and Techniques

Statistical methods are fundamental in validating data integrity. Techniques such as hypothesis testing, regression analysis, and correlation analysis help in understanding the relationships between different variables and detecting outliers. By applying these methods, you can ensure that your data is consistent and reliable.

# 3. Data Validation Rules and Policies

Developing and implementing robust data validation rules and policies is essential. These rules should cover various aspects such as data format, range, and consistency. By defining clear validation rules, you can create a systematic approach to data quality management, reducing the risk of errors and ensuring data accuracy.

Best Practices for Data Validation

Mastering data validation techniques involves not only understanding the tools and methods but also adhering to best practices that enhance the effectiveness of these techniques. Some key best practices include:

# 1. Automated Validation Processes

Automating data validation processes can significantly improve efficiency and accuracy. Automated tools can quickly and consistently apply validation rules across large datasets, reducing the risk of human error. Additionally, automated validation can provide real-time insights into data quality, enabling timely corrective actions.

# 2. Continuous Monitoring and Feedback

Continuous monitoring of data quality is essential to maintain integrity over time. Regular audits and feedback loops help in identifying and addressing issues early. By integrating monitoring tools and processes, you can ensure that data remains reliable and up-to-date.

# 3. Integration with Enterprise Systems

Data validation should be integrated into the broader enterprise systems to ensure consistency and reliability across all data sources. This integration helps in maintaining a unified view of data, reducing the risk of discrepancies and ensuring that data is aligned with organizational goals.

Career Opportunities in Data Integrity

Mastering validation techniques for data integrity opens up a plethora of career opportunities in data-driven industries. Some of the roles that benefit from this expertise include:

# 1. Data Quality Analyst

Data quality analysts are responsible for ensuring that data is accurate, complete, and consistent. They use various techniques to validate data and develop strategies to improve data quality. This role is critical in industries such as healthcare, finance, and retail.

# 2. Data Validation Engineer

Data validation engineers focus on designing and implementing systems for data validation. They work closely with data scientists and engineers to ensure that data is reliable and usable. This role is particularly in demand in tech companies and large enterprises.

# 3. Data Governance Specialist

Data governance specialists are responsible for managing the policies, processes, and standards that govern data within an organization. They ensure that data is used ethically and securely, aligning with organizational goals. This role is crucial in industries where data privacy and security are paramount.
